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

Asbestos lawyers are committed to helping families of victims get the financial help they deserve. These attorneys are employed by national companies that have access to asbestos databases and a track record of winning significant cases and settlements.

They assist mesothelioma sufferers to make a personal injury or wrongful death lawsuit against the companies that caused their exposure. The majority of these cases are settled before trial.

Obtaining an appropriate settlement

Finding a fair compensation for a mesothelioma suit settlement requires a skilled asbestos lawyer. They will assess the details of a case, and ensure that they have sufficient evidence to get a verdict or settle a lawsuit. They also assist the plaintiff and family members in obtaining any medical treatment that is needed. These services are typically covered by workers' compensation, so the victim will get them at no cost.

An attorney will begin by compiling all relevant information regarding the asbestos-related illness, including dates of exposure as well as locations. The attorney will then forward this information to the defendant and wait for their response. The defendant may attempt to slash or deny the amount of settlement. In these instances an attorney will advise the client to decline the offer and proceed to trial instead.

A lawsuit can take a long time to prepare and can cost a lot of money and time. A seasoned lawyer will make sure that their clients understand each step of the procedure and will keep them informed on any progress that occurs. They will also assist the victims and their families get any medical care they need, as well as financial support.

Mesothelioma attorneys will attempt to speed up the legal process, even if the defendants try to prolong the litigation. It is essential that potential victims and their families submit a claim before the statute of limitations expiring. An experienced lawyer will be able to avoid this mistake and help them file a suit before it's too late.

There are many different kinds of mesothelioma lawsuits that patients and their families can bring. These include personal injury, wrongful death, and trust fund claims. Most mesothelioma cases are filed as a single case, not in a class action. This is due to the fact that it has been shown that mesothelioma patients receive more compensation in individual lawsuits than from settlements for class actions. The proceeds of the lawsuit will be distributed to the plaintiffs when the case has been settled. If medical professionals have imposed liens, these have to be paid prior the funds being released.

Getting the medical treatment you require

A mesothelioma settlement could help victims pay medical bills. It also covers other costs like lost wages and emotional distress. Compensation can also pay for family members who may need to care for a loved one. To get a mesothelioma compensation, the victim or their loved ones must engage an experienced mesothelioma attorney. A mesothelioma lawyer can handle the intricate state tort law involved in asbestos cases.

Mesothelioma lawsuits seek financial compensation from businesses which exposed victims to asbestos. Typically these companies are responsible for exposing people to asbestos at work or from asbestos-containing products in their homes. Asbestos exposure can take years before it develops into mesothelioma, among other asbestos-related illnesses. Most mesothelioma lawsuits are settled outside of the court. However, some cases are brought to trial, where jurors hear the evidence and awards damages.

When pursuing a mesothelioma claim it is crucial to gather as much information on asbestos exposure as is possible. This will help the attorneys create a case against defendants. A mesothelioma lawyer will make sure that their client has all the legal documents needed to file a suit.

In many instances, the lawyers of a mesothelioma patient will make a claim against multiple defendants. It is difficult to pinpoint which company is responsible for mesothelioma that affects an individual. It could be that different asbestos producers and employers exposed the victim to asbestos.

Asbestos lawyers can also help their clients with the filing of mesothelioma trust fund claims. These funds are a result of asbestos-related companies that have gone bankrupt because of bankruptcy laws in their states. The trusts are worth more than $30 billion of assets accessible to asbestos victims.

The most effective mesothelioma lawyers combine their legal knowledge with compassion and empathy towards their clients. They understand how stressful a mesothelioma diagnosis can be and do everything they can to make sure their clients get the compensation they deserve.

Baron & Budd's mesothelioma attorneys were among the first in the nation to tackle asbestos litigation, and have won numerous precedent-setting cases through the years. Their commitment to assist asbestos victims has never wavered and they continue to fight for those who are affected by mesothelioma or any other asbestos settlement-related diseases.

Get the financial support you require

Getting the financial support you require can ease your stress during treatment, help pay for medical expenses and make ends meet. Compensation for mesothelioma may help pay for future and past medical treatment and legal costs, loss of income and earning capacity loss as well as pain and discomfort and other damages. The amount you are awarded varies depending on your state and type of mesothelioma. There are three types of mesothelioma claims: personal injury, wrongful deaths, and trust funds. In a personal injury lawsuit you seek compensation from the person who caused your condition. This is the most common mesothelioma lawsuit. The wrongful death claim is filed by relatives of mesothelioma sufferers and seek compensation from the company or businesses responsible for the victim's death.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ma fund is filed at one of the many asbestos trust funds established by the government or asbestos companies.

It could take years to settle a lawsuit. A fair settlement can be difficult to negotiate. Some asbestos companies attempt to delay the process by filing frivolous lawsuits. Your mesothelioma lawyer has experience at finding these tactics and stopping them.

There are different laws which apply based on the state in which you reside and what kind of asbestos exposure you had. Some states have shorter statutes of limitations, while others have longer timeframes to file a lawsuit.

A mesothelioma-related case can last for years. Judges can speed up the trial if the plaintiff has a short life expectancy or is in a serious health condition. The judge in charge of the case will decide whether there is a valid reason to speed up the process. The court will then require the defendants to respond to the plaintiff's claims.

The VA healthcare system provides veterans with access to the most skilled mesothelioma specialists in the country and disability compensation. The VA also provides special nursing care for mesothelioma patients. Mesothelioma lawyers can explain how you can combine the benefits of both programs to obtain the most amount of compensation.

Just Justice

Mesothelioma lawsuits are a way for patients and their families to receive justice. These lawsuits allow the victims to hold asbestos-related companies accountable for their exposure to this dangerous mineral. They also can help victims to receive compensation for their suffering. These lawsuits can be settled prior to trial or by the verdict of a jury. A judge will decide on the amount of compensation a victim is entitled to. A mesothelioma lawyer can help their clients get the maximum amount of compensation they can get.

People who have been diagnosed as having mesothelioma or lung cancer, or any other asbestos-related disease are able to make a claim. asbestos compensation litigation can be difficult however, it is crucial to work with a knowledgeable asbestos attorney to ensure that your rights are secured. These attorneys have a proven track of success and the resources to create strong cases for their clients.

A mesothelioma settlement could cover a wide range of costs which include lost wages, funeral costs, medical bills and grief support. It can also be used to cover future medical expenses. Compensation might not cover all costs but it can make a significant difference.
